The L-1A visa is the intracompany transferee category for managers and executives. It allows a U.S. company to bring in a qualifying employee from a related office abroad, provided the two entities share a qualifying corporate relationship and the employee worked in a managerial, executive or specialized knowledge role abroad for at least one continuous year out of the previous three.
Time in the category is finite. A regular L-1A petition is normally approved for three years, and extensions are granted in increments of up to two years, to a maximum of seven years in L-1A status.
Executive cases carry their own burden. USCIS looks past the job title and asks whether the applicant meets the L-1A executive requirements: directing the management of the organization, setting its goals and policies, and exercising wide discretion under only general supervision. Where the applicant also owns the company, that analysis gets harder, because the petition has to show an organization with enough structure that the executive is not the person handling day-to-day operations.
Company size matters too. Smaller companies tend to draw closer scrutiny, and the petition has to explain clearly how the business works and who performs which functions.
